Man charged with arson after coaches set alight at Henley-in-Arden depot

A man has been charged with arson following a blaze at a local coach depot over the weekend.

Firefighters and police were called to the blaze at Johnsons Coaches on Liveridge Hill at 1.36am on Saturday 30 November.

Multiple coaches were caught alight, as were six other cars parked in the vicinity.

Warwickshire Police "quickly" arrested 29-year-old Christopher White from Croome Close in Redditch at the scene.

He has subsequently been charged with arson not endangering life.

He has been remanded in custody and will appear before Warwick Crown Court on Monday, 6 January.

Johnsons said on Facebook page: "The incident was well coordinated, and the fire was successfully contained and extinguished, but it caused significant damage to multiple coaches and cars.

"We would like to thank the emergency services for their swift response and our staff and local community for their support during this difficult time."
